Georgie Green Takes Flight begins the story of Georgie Green and introduces readers to his New Hampshire town and his neighbors. I have always believed in the thought that "It takes a Village to raise a village" and the characters of Winsett Village are no exception!

Twelve year old Georgie Green believes, without question, that he is meant for great and extraordinary things! He knows he has the ability to fly if only he can train his body to do what his mind knows he can! Georgie believes that this flying ability will come once he is able to transform into a great bird and one day, with practice and determination, he will succeed! But, when he starts noticing strange changes...is he really ready for what's to come!
